Robert L. LaHotan (American/Maine, 1927-2002), "Calendulas", watercolor on paper, signed lower right, titled en verso, sight 8 1/2 in. x 10 1/2 in., framed.

  • Notes: Note: LaHotan was a longtime resident of Great Cranberry Island, Maine and a beloved member of its artistic community. Along with his partner and fellow painter John Heliker, he created a foundation to encourage and foster the enduring artistic legacy of the community. In accordance with the artists' wishes, their estate has been converted to a residence for painters and sculptors. LaHotan received a Fulbright Grant in 1951 and was a member of the National Academy of Art. Reference: New York Times Obituary, September 6, 2003 Heliker-LaHotan.org
